WebBTFS is a fork of IPFS. However, BTFS hosts a variety of unique features. For example, BTFS has native support for both file removal and file encryption/decryption. This allows users to easily remove illegal or copyrighted material on their nodes as well as securely transfer and store files. BTFS is also uniquely integrated with the TRON ... WebAs a basic unit in the BFTS system, a node can serve as a host or a renter. The two roles are not mutually exclusive, so a node can be both a host and renter. The revenue of a …
WebEvery storage node (host) in the BTFS network has to stake BTT. Files uploaded by renters will be sent to hosts, recommended based on their staking amount or staking rate, or in a …
